January 2008

Thursday 31st - Bahama Pintail (Presumed Escaped).

Monday 28th - Red Crested Pochard.

Sunday 27th - 9 x Pintail, 20 x Tree Sparrow, 3 x Willow Tit, Reed Bunting 4 x Ruddy Duck (All from Kingfisher Hide

Saturday 26th - Red Crested Pochard (Female) (near visitor centre), Delta: Common Snipe. Erewash Field: 3 Common Snipe, 7 Meadow Pipit, 2 Skylark.

Thursday 24th - 6 x Siskin.

Monday 21st  - Chiffchaff [in full song at 10:00 from inside the sewage works just West of Barton Lane level crossing].

Saturday 19th - 6 x Common Redpoll, 6 x Bullfinch, Red-Necked Grebe.

Friday 18th - Red-Necked Grebe (Still Present).

Tuesday 15th - 2 Bittern [opposite Delta Hide, showing well briefly at 14:15].

Monday 14th -  2 Pintail, 1 Red necked Grebe - Clifton Pit, view from Kingfisher hide

Sunday 13th - 1 Red necked Grebe - Clifton Pit, view from Kingfisher hide, 28 Shoveler [Church Pond], Water Rail, c.20 Great Crested Grebe, 3 Little Grebe, c.10 Gadwall, c.10 Common Pochard, c.20 Tufted Duck, c.100 Mallard, 2 Goosander [1 male, 1 female], c.200 Northern Lapwing, c.1500 Woodpigeon, c.10 Collared Dove, c.400 Starling, c.2000 Rook, c.20 Black-headed Gull, Mute Swan, 2 Egyptian Goose, c.20 Canada Goose, c.100 Coot, c.50 Moorhen, Robin, Tree Sparrow, Chaffinch, Great Tit, Blue Tit, Blackbird, Magpie

Saturday 12th - Bittern, Red-necked Grebe [showing down to a few feet on the Clifton Pond in front of the Kingfisher Hide], Mediterranean Gull [a first-year bird on reedbed island], 1 Little Egret [also on reedbed island before flying towards the Coneries roost at 16:00], 1 Chiffchaff [Wet Marsh], 28+ Common Gull [Clifton pit].

Friday 11th - 1 x Bittern

Thursday 10th - 1 Bittern  

Sunday 6th - 2 Bittern 

Saturday 5th - Brambling (River Path), 2 x Willow Tit.

Friday 4th - Greater Black-Backed Gull, Great Spotted Woodpecker (Willows Peninsula), 25 Tree Sparrows (Willows Peninsula).

Thursday 3rd - Bahama Pintail (presumed escaped), 2 x Red Crested Pochard, 2 Bittern.

Wednesday 2nd - 2 Red-crested Pochard [a pair on Main Pond], 3 Bittern [Delta Hide from 15:30], Water Rail, Kingfisher, 8 Goosander, Bullfinch.
